The Weedmaps Team Pulls Into the Desert to Test DSRT Surf

We've all seen this new dreamy wave pool pop up in Palm Desert. A couple days ago, the Weedmaps team did an expedition out to the desert to legit check this wave, and it's worth the hype. DSRT Surf sits out there with mountains on one side, palm trees on the other, and a Wavegarden Cove setup pumping out barrels. It doesn't debut to the public until later this summer, so when the Weedmaps athlete team rolled up with "Zeke" Jacob Szekely, Nathan Fletcher, and Bruce Irons, they were some of the first people on earth to actually surf the finished lagoon. Szekely called it flat out one of the best all-around pools he's ever surfed, saying the barrel is "pretty long and super playful" and that the air sections are "next level," built with a custom ramp the Wavegarden engineers helped design just for airs.

The whole session ran deep with surf royalty, Nathan Fletcher, Bruce Irons, Bob Martinez, and Matt Archibald all sharing waves. For Szekely, watching his heroes go off in the same pool felt less like a surf trip and more like a skate session, everyone hooting, everyone getting a piece of the action. As he put it, "everybody got nugs, everybody was doing sick combos," and the whole thing just felt like a moto sesh or a day at the skate park, the kind of energy he said he wants to be part of going forward. The session ran straight into the night too, with some of the best airs of the whole day landing after dark.
